Ingredients

This black bean and corn salad has an incredible homemade tangy lime vinaigrette dressing. It’s delicious yet healthy, and you’ll want to serve it with every summer meal!

  • 1/2 cup uncooked white rice
  • 1 avocado (diced)
  • 1 (14 fluid ounce) can black beans (drained & rinsed)
  • 1 (12 fluid ounce) can corn (or use fresh corn cut off the cob) (drained)
  • 1-2 tablespoons red onion (chopped)
  • 2 tablespoons fresh cilantro (chopped)
  • Salt & pepper (to taste)
  • 1/4 cup ol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ons lime juice + zest of 1 lime
  • 1 teaspoon honey
  • 1/2 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der

How to Make Black Bean Corn Avocado Salad

Step 1: Cook the Rice

Cook the rice according to package directions. Once done, let it cool completely before adding it to the salad.

Step 2: Prepare the Dressing

In a small bowl, add the following ingredients:
1/4 cup olive oil
2 tablespoons lime juice + zest of 1 lime
1 teaspoon honey
1/2 teaspoon chili powder
1/4 teaspoon garlic powder

Whisk together until well blended.

Step 3: Combine Ingredients

In a large salad bowl, add:
The cooled rice
Diced avocado
Drained black beans
Drained corn
Chopped red onion
Chopped cilantro

Pour the dressing over the mixture. Toss gently to combine all ingredients thoroughly.

Step 4: Season and Chill

Season generously with salt & pepper. Taste and adjust as needed—add more lime juice if desired. Cover and chill in the refrigerator for about an hour before serving or enjoy immediately!

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Making a black bean corn avocado salad can be simple, but there are common mistakes that can affect its taste and presentation. Here are some to watch out for:

  • Skipping the seasoning: Failing to season your salad properly can lead to bland flavors. Always taste and adjust the seasoning before serving.
  • Not cooling the rice: Adding warm rice can make the salad mushy. Allow the rice to cool completely before mixing it with other ingredients.
  • Over-mixing: Mixing too vigorously can break down the avocado and make it mushy. Gently toss the ingredients to keep the textures intact.
  • Ignoring freshness: Using old or wilted vegetables will impact flavor. Always use fresh ingredients for the best results.
  • Not chilling long enough: Serving right away might not allow the flavors to blend. Chill for at least an hour to enhance taste.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1/2 cup uncooked white rice
  • 1 avocado (diced)
  • 1 (14 oz) can black beans (drained & rinsed)
  • 1 (12 oz) can corn (or fresh corn off the cob)
  • 12 tablespoons red onion (chopped)
  • 2 tablespoons fresh cilantro (chopped)
  • Salt & pepper (to taste)
  • 1/4 cup ol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ons lime juice + zest of 1 lime
  • 1 teaspoon honey
  • 1/2 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der

Instructions

  1. Cook the rice according to package directions and let cool.
  2. In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il, lime juice and zest, honey, chili powder, and garlic powder.
  3. In a large bowl, combine cooled rice, diced avocado, black beans, corn, red onion, and cilantro.
  4. Pour dressing over the salad mixture and toss gently to combine.
  5.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Chill for at least one hour before serving.
